1. Craft, Hobby and Stitch International (CHSI)
As the UK’s premier craft trade show, Craft, Hobby and Stitch International attracts over 6,000 buyers annually, offering unparalleled exposure for artisans and craft suppliers. Exhibitors can connect with buyers seeking the latest trends and innovative products in the world of craft, from textiles to bespoke home décor.
Date: 25th – 26th February 2024
Location: NEC, Birmingham
2. Craft 4 Crafters Show
A staple in the crafting community for over two decades, the Craft 4 Crafters Show in Exeter draws an audience of more than 12,000 craft lovers. This event is ideal for vendors in the quilting, textile, and sewing sectors, offering valuable networking opportunities and a chance to showcase your goods in front of a large, engaged audience.
Date: 4th – 6th April 2024
Location: Westpoint Centre, Exeter

4. British Craft Trade Fair (BCTF)
The British Craft Trade Fair in Harrogate is a high-profile event for artisans focused on handmade and high-quality designs. Collaborating with Handmade in Britain, this fair is a magnet for retailers, galleries, and stockists looking to source original, handcrafted products from emerging and established makers.
Date: 7th – 8th April 2024
Location: Yorkshire Event Centre, Harrogate
5. Weald of Kent Country Craft Show
Hosted at the stunning Penshurst Place, the Weald of Kent Country Craft Show is perfect for vendors offering outdoor, garden, fashion, or decorative home products. With over 250 stalls, this three-day event is filled with demonstrations, workshops, and family-friendly activities, making it a must-visit for both buyers and exhibitors alike.
Date: 4th – 6th May 2024
Location: Penshurst Place, Tonbridge

8. Festival of Crafts
Held annually at Farnham Maltings, the Festival of Crafts brings together a curated group of artisans from across the UK. This event showcases a diverse mix of homewares, ceramics, jewellery, and more, with a focus on both modern and traditional techniques. It’s a must-attend for craft lovers and collectors alike.
Date: 12th – 13th October 2024
Location: Farnham Maltings, Surrey
9. Handmade in Britain
The Handmade in Britain fair in Chelsea is the perfect place to display your contemporary crafts to an audience of collectors, retail buyers, and press. Known for its high-end, artisan-focused atmosphere, this event offers exhibitors the opportunity to build valuable connections and drive significant sales.
Date: 6th – 9th November 2024
Location: Chelsea Old Town Hall, London

Tips for a Successful Craft Stall
- Design an eye-catching stall – Use branded banners, foamex boards, and packaging to ensure your stall stands out.
- Engage with your audience – Craft fairs are about personal connections. Take time to explain your work to potential buyers.
- Leave a lasting impression – Even if a sale isn’t made, hand out business cards and offer promotional materials to keep your brand on their radar.
